【问题标题】:Android Studio wrong breakpointsAndroid Studio 错误断点
【发布时间】:2017-07-06 09:10:10
【问题描述】:

我尝试调试一些代码,但 Android Studio 调试器今天的行为很奇怪。

它接受随机断点。没有可执行代码预览的地方有时会显示有。并且对于可执行行预览表示代码不可执行。

我尝试同步、清理、重建、使现金无效/重新启动,但没有效果。

以前有人遇到过这个问题吗?解决方法是什么?

【问题讨论】:

  • 前一行是什么
  • 我刚刚更新了屏幕截图以广泛显示问题。

标签: android android-studio debugging android-debug


【解决方案1】:

重建项目可能会解决问题。

【讨论】:

    【解决方案2】:

    这是一个无效的断点,当断点设置在注释或不可执行的行上时显示该断点不会被命中。

    【讨论】:

    • 是的,我知道,但是为什么调试器认为只有大括号的行是可执行的,而将变量值设置为不可执行的行?
    • 只是说不能执行,因为在if里面。条件为真或假,因此该行可以在它为真时执行,而不是在它为假时执行。
    猜你喜欢
    • 1970-01-01
    • 2013-12-04
    • 1970-01-01
    • 2020-04-30
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2014-07-25
    • 2015-04-16
    相关资源
    最近更新 更多